Output 84b463b3920bdd7fc0d52f143411bc47ab69c297ced063d61558113577e3537a:5

value
565720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f13c41a6e191179487bd9207ef7f98dd674e7f7 OP_EQUAL
address
34XLYrjJXUP7hDFEELEKftXGdikVBwHFF5
transaction
84b463b3920bdd7fc0d52f143411bc47ab69c297ced063d61558113577e3537a
spent
true